Quick note on Chatterbox, our noisiest service: we sample logs at 5% in prod, 100% in staging. Don't crank the rate up to debug — use the trace-flag header instead, which forces full logging for one request. Sampling config lives in the observability repo. If something looks under-sampled or broken, ping the observability crew.

escalation mailbox, bafog-fafog: ulador@paliqlabs.internal

**Vendor note: Inkmill markdown pipeline**

Rendering for Parchway docs is outsourced to Inkmill under an annual contract, renewing each March. They handle sanitization and PDF export; we own the upload queue. SLA: 4-hour response on rendering failures. Escalate only after two failed retries. Their support desk is reachable at the address below.

billing contact of hahaf-baguf = zorael.tammir.jorius@sivrelhq.internal

## Deployment: Cold Storage Archival

Glacierline archives inactive buckets from the Fennwick data tier after 180 days of no reads. The archiver runs as a scheduled job in the Ossuary cluster and requires write access only to the manifest index, never to live object data. Lifecycle rules are immutable once applied; rollback requires a restore ticket. For audit purposes, the reviewer should verify the job runs with the following configuration values.

deployment values, yadug-bawif:
[framir]
team = pelox
access_code = ac_a38ab2
owner = tamion.julael
host = framir.tolvaqlabs.test
port = 11211
peer = tammir.zemvargrid.local
salt = 2215ef03
pin = 1541

// Broker upgrade notes for plugin authors:
// Quillbus 4.x replaces the legacy 3.x wire protocol. Plugins must
// construct the client with explicit protocol negotiation enabled,
// or connections to the Larkfield cluster will be silently downgraded
// and dropped after 30s. Topic names are unchanged. For local testing
// against the sandbox broker, authenticate with the key below.

API key for bafof-bagaf: qvz2-qi